Appellants, Texas American Corporation ("Texas American") and William Edmonds, appeal the judgment rendered on a jury verdict against them and in favor of appellee, Woodbridge Joint Venture. This suit arises from two contracts for sale of real estate in a subdivision in Hurst, Texas ("Woodbridge"), entered into by appellee and appellants. Appellee, who was the developer of Woodbridge, contracted to sell subdivision lots to appellants...
